Turntable Kitchen

Turntable Kitchen is a side project by a San Francisco couple combining cooking with music, two of my favorite things!  You can look up recipes along with the selected playlist on their website, but my favorite part?  You can sign up to receive a 'pairings box' each month.  The package contains the recipe, dry ingredients and playlist (on a seven inch vinyl single!) all bundled up in a brown box with white string.  I want to sign up!

Pumpkin Cake

My aunt Carolyn made this for Drea and I on our last trip to California and it is one of my new favorite fall treats.  Best served cold with lots of whipped cream!

1 package angel food cake mix
1 29oz can pumpkin filling
1 1/2 tablespoons pumpkin pie spice
1 cup water

Mix all ingredients together, pour into a 9x13 non-greased baking dish and bake for 40 min at 350 degrees.  Let cool completely before serving, add whipped topping.

Single Serving Chocolate Chip Cookie

This is the best and worst thing I have ever found on the Internet.  Perfect to curb my new constant craving for a chocolate chip cookie....and no I wasn't eating this in bed so don't ask.  My mouth is waterrrriiiiiing...

1 tbsp melted butter
1 tbsp sugar
1 tbsp brown sugar
3 drops of vanilla
pinch of salt
1 egg yolk
1/4 cup flour
2 tbsp chocolate chips

Mix together in a deep bowl or mug and microwave for 40-60 seconds
